He once told me a funny story about a road march they were on...
They all marched/ran with all their combat gear...my dad knowing he would have to carry his heavy weapon cut off a broom stick and put black shoe polish on it and replaced the barrel with it.
Towards the end of their march his sergeant felt bad about him having to carry his machine gun the whole way offered to carry it for him...my dad said no...but the Sargent insisted on it so my father handed it over.
As the sergeant grabbed it and expected a much heavier weapon almost threw the gun over his shoulder.
After some smart ass remark handed it back to my dad to carry the rest of the way.

Of interest:

I tend to believe Karen McCoy's 1992 revelation that she was a heavy participant in the Utah hijacking, and the other things she said in her efforts to stop sales of the Calame book.

Why? Because she was taking a risk by admitting to a capital crime. There was no John Doe warrant in the Utah hijacking, such as was issued for the Cooper hijacking. So, it's possible the Feds would have found a way to charge her as an accomplice, although they never did.

An excerpt from the Utah article, with a link to the full story below:

  Quote

'Karen McCoy, the widow of slain hijacker Richard McCoy, revealed for the first time Thursday her extensive involvement in her husband's 1972 hijacking of United Airlines Flight 855.During a daylong hearing in 3rd District Court, McCoy acknowledged that she bought her husband's parachute, helped him prepare his disguise, typed the instructions he read to the airline pilots, drove him to the Salt Lake International Airport April 7, 1972, to begin the crime and knew he took a gun and grenade aboard the plane.

At 3 a.m. the next morning, Karen also drove with her husband to a field near Springville to pick up and hide the $500,000 McCoy extorted during the day-long hijacking that ended when he parachuted over Provo.

Under questioning from her own attorney, Karen blamed her involvement in part on the fact that she had been "severely physically and sexually abused" when she was younger...'



Link to full article is HERE.

Also of interest is the fact that although Karen McCoy admits to all these things, she also strongly denied that McCoy was D.B. Cooper. It doesn't make sense that she would say this unless it were true. She could have easily blamed that on her deceased husband, and possibly used that fact to bargain with the Feds. I tend to believe she was telling the truth on both accounts, i.e. that she helped with the Utah crime, but knew her husband wasn't Cooper.

Maybe. In a previous interview, Rataczak alludes to being in contact with Soderlind on the ground, after the takeoff from Seattle:

  Quote

'I do know that our technical support people who were on the radio with us during the hijacking, especially Paul Soderlind (sic), tried to determine the exact area where Cooper might have jumped. We relied heavily on him for technical information during the flight. He was head of Technical Operations in our Flight Training Department. Paul and many others did a lot of work trying to determine the exact area in general (where Cooper jumped), and then tried to narrow down where the hijacker could have landed after he jumped from the airplane.

They finally determined the likely spot. Well, our crew on board was 99% sure they were correct because we felt a tremendous amount of pressure bump in our ears when the aft stairs rebounded when they closed...'
